In 1888, Frederick Elliott entered the world in Massachusetts, born to Bridgefort Elliott And Deborah L O Neal. In 1900, Frederick Elliott resided in Medford Ward 5, Middlesex, Massachusetts, USA. In 1910, Frederick Elliott resided in Boston Ward 14, Suffolk, Massachusetts, USA. Frederick Elliott married Annie M Flynn, Bernice M Batchelder, and had children including Frederick A Elliott, Leroy Albert Elliott, Mary Elizabeth Elliott. Frederick Elliott passed away in 1945 in Upland, Delaware, Pennsylvania, USA.
